Shifting Away from Retail Reliance

Intellicheck's Q4 2023 and Q1 2024 earnings calls both hinted at a deliberate move away from its historical reliance on retail transaction volumes. This strategic move is not merely a response to temporary headwinds in the retail sector but a proactive approach to tap into more resilient and lucrative markets.

This shift is evidenced by Intellicheck's expansion into various sectors, including:

- **Banking and Finance:** Securing partnerships with regional and top-tier banks for digital and in-branch use cases.

- **Global Media:** Expanding internationally, providing identity verification services for a renowned global media company in the U.K.

- **Cryptocurrency:** Signing agreements with crypto wallet companies for user validation during account opening.

The Mystery of the "Large Customer"

Intriguingly, Intellicheck's Q1 2024 earnings call mentioned a "large customer" operating in a "non-financial vertical" whose delayed launch impacted the company's guidance. This customer, bound by a strict NDA, has stringent security requirements and a critical need for authentication. CEO Bryan Lewis stated that this customer "will prove to be one of our largest customers" and a "substantial revenue generator," sparking speculation about a potentially game-changing partnership.

""As we approach the midway point of 2024, we believe there is opportunity for growth on multiple fronts, including existing customers, new customers and with additional use cases. What we anticipate will prove to be one of our largest customers who had expected to go live in April has pushed back on their timing. The delay is for good reason. They have made the decision to integrate Intellicheck’s technology into other internal systems as well before going live with us. We anticipate having additional color on this large opportunity over the next few months." - Intellicheck Q1 2024 Earnings Call Transcript"

Average Price Per Scan

Intellicheck has consistently reported an increasing average price per scan, indicating the growing value its customers place on its solutions. This trend is driven by right-sizing legacy account pricing, implementing CPI increases, and securing new customers at higher rates.

""Continuing to cast a critical eye to the metrics of our SaaS revenue, it’s encouraging to see an 18% increase in our average price per scan versus the prior year as we have largely completed right-sizing the pricing of our legacy accounts, enforced internal disciplines on CPI increases and signed new customers at higher rates than we have traditionally executed." - Intellicheck Q1 2024 Earnings Call Transcript"
